Product Description
ISO 9239 Flooring Material Radiant Heat Flux Testing Machine ASTM E648
The flooring material combustion performance tester measures the combustion performance of various flooring materials, including textile carpets, cork boards, wood boards, rubber boards, plastic flooring, and floor coatings. Test results accurately reflect the combustion performance of the flooring material and its substrate. The testing method involves igniting horizontally placed flooring material in an inclined thermal radiation field with a small flame within a test combustion chamber to assess the material's flame propagation capability.
Applicable Standards
  • ASTM E648 Standard Test for Critical Radiant Flux of Floor Coating Systems Using Radiant Heat Sources
  • BS EN ISO 9239-1 Fire Reaction Tests for Floor Coverings - Determination of Flame Propagation Performance Using Radiant Heat Sources
  • BS EN ISO 9239-2 Fire Resistance Tests for Floors - Part 2: Determination of Flame Propagation at a Heat Flux Level of 25 kW/m²
  • GB/T 11785 Determination of Flame Propagation Performance of Floor Coverings - Radiant Heat Source Method
Technical Specifications
Radiant Heat Source Radiant surface dimensions: (300×450)mm±10mm; Radiant plate withstands temperatures up to 900℃
Propane Rotor Flow Rate Propane gas flow rate: (0.026±0.002) L/s; Ignition flame height: (60~120)mm
Flue Gas Exhaust Exhaust velocity: 2.5±0.2 m/s; Exhaust capacity: 39~85 m³/min; Hot-wire anemometer measures flow velocity with ±0.1 m/s accuracy
Water-cooled Heat Flux Meter Measurement range: 0~50 KW/m²
Heat Flux Meter Accuracy ±0.2 Kw/m²
Heat Flux Meter Precision Precision: <±2%

Key Features
  • Stainless steel test chamber with front-opening door design for easy cleaning
  • Inner walls made of high-temperature resistant calcium silicate board
  • Stainless steel fume hood above combustion test chamber
  • 300mm x 450mm porous ceramic heat radiation plate at 30-degree angle
  • T-type porous burner with electric cylinder drive for open flame application
  • Optical system with 2900 ± 100 K color temperature incandescent lamp and light intensity sensor
  • Rotor flow meter for T-type burner flame height adjustment
  • Propane glass rotor flow meter with digital display for gas flow rate control
  • Integrated blower with Venturi mixture for test gas mixing
  • Domestic water-cooled heat flow meter (0-50 kW/m² range, <±2% accuracy, 0.2s response time)
  • Portable cooling water source - no external water supply required
  • Movable heat flux meter for radiant panel calibration with software-generated standard heat radiation flux curve
  • Foot switch for automatic flame spread time recording by computer
  • Chimney thermocouple and internal thermocouple with computer display
  • Infrared radiometer for radiant panel temperature detection
  • Industrial computer with testing software for complete combustion process monitoring
  • Variable frequency PID control for improved smoke exhaust stability
  • Software displays heat radiation flux values, smoke density curves, transmittance curves, and wind speed
Laboratory Requirements
  • Power supply: AC220V/2KW 50HZ with safety grounding wire
  • Temperature: 0~55℃
  • Humidity: <85%RH
  • Footprint: 3m×1.5m×2.7m (length×width×height)
